sapphire 5830 bending

last week i given (gift from parents) the sapphire 5830 to crossfire it with the 5830 i already had , today i install some new case fans and noticed the rear of the gfx card looks like it is bending down at the rear of the card where the power cables fit . is this a common problem ? , will it damage the card ? . the pcb seems weak to me and i am worried it may cause problems in the future



i have measured it to the bottom of the case .
pcb is 157mm from the bottom of the case near the crossfire connectors , the rear is 153mm to the bottom of the case . also the pcb seems thinner on the sapphire card compaired to the powercolor card , if i put something to prop it up the pcb on the end rises but the end of the cooler does not

keep an eye on it, if it gets worse after some weeks or months then its not too good

but imo. bent cards mostly comes when you get non reference cards, the non reference coolers tend to mess the card a bit
